**Ticket PIX-412: resizecli drops EXIF orientation on batch runs.** Repro steps: (1) install resizecli 2.3 from the Hollowpine registry, (2) run a batch resize against the sample set in the shared fixtures bucket, (3) compare output orientation to source. Portrait images render rotated. Expected: orientation preserved. To pull the fixtures bucket, authenticate the download request with the bearer token below.

session JWT of yawep-yawep = eyJhbGciOiJIUzI1NiIsInR5cCI6IkpXVCJ9.eyJzdWIiOiI3pWF3_In0.aXYsHiog

Leadership Review Briefing — Branch Managers

Subject: Change of Logistics Provider

Effective next quarter, distribution for the Westmere network moves from Caldrin Freight to Ostrova Haulage. Expected benefits: shorter lead times on the Penley corridor and consolidated billing. Branches should complete handover checklists before cutover. Rationale tied to broader plans is set out in the confidential note below.

board note of bawep-tajef: Queniusek Systems plans to raise the Quenvan list price by 53.1 percent in March. The pricing group signed off on a budget of $176.4 million for Project Drueth. The renewal with Casionix Partners closes at $142.5 million a year, 8.3 percent below the last contract. Project Fraax slips by six weeks because of the tooling delay.

Facilities ticket — Halewick Tower, night shift.

Issue: support team reporting east stairwell reader rejecting badges after midnight. Reader was reset this morning; firmware updated. Overnight crew should now badge as normal. If the reader fails again, use the manual keypad by the fire door — do not prop the door. Log any further failures with the time and badge name. Temporary keypad code for the fallback door is below.

door code, tajeg-fawip: bdg-K-62

Proposed structure: a standalone entity, equal governance, with our side contributing process patents and Ostermere contributing plant capacity in Calderbrook. Diligence findings to date are favorable, though supply-chain exposure warrants further review. Board approval is required before term-sheet execution. The confidential assessment of strategic fit and timing is recorded below.

board note of bahif-yajef: Only 9 of the 120 pilot accounts renewed Oliwyn, so a churn review is set for January 1.